Check out these renders of the iPhone 8 allegedly based on 'real blueprints' seen by Benjamin Geskin.

My source showed me real blueprints, 3D model, etc. With all the details. I can't share those but was able the create this renders. It's 1:1

The prototype iPhone 8 purportedly has a 4mm bezel on all four sides of the front display. Touch ID and the front facing camera are said to be embedded into display. This differs from another prototype whose schematics allegedly leaked recently. That prototype had a larger bezel on the top and bottom with the earpiece and front camera in the top bezel and the Touch ID sensor on the back of the device.

Claimed Features:
● Front-facing Touch ID beneath the display.
● 4mm bezels around the entire edge of the device.
● 2.5D contoured glass on the front and back of the device surrounded by a metal frame.
● Wireless charging.
● Same dimensions as the iPhone 7.
● 5.8″ OLED display.
● “Invisible” front-facing camera hidden underneath the display.
● Large power button featuring two points of contact. Reason unknown.

According to Geskin, there are two main prototypes being tested by Apple right now. The other is allegedly being considered because there have been issues embedding the Touch ID sensor into the display.
